About The Event

Back by popular demand! Due to the popularity of the Art of Beer classes last fall, we are offering the class again this spring, on Wednesday, March 19, at 6:00 p.m., and on Friday, April 11, at 6:00 p.m. Stay tuned for the Art of Beer: Part 2, coming this summer!

Join us for a unique adult-education class at the CMA, where we delve into the fascinating art of beer! Explore artworks from the museum’s collection that highlight the rich history of making and drinking beer, spanning from the ancient world to medieval times. Held in the museum’s banquet room, this immersive class also features a curated beer tasting of five beers paired with small bites. Led by art historian Amanda Mikolic, who is also known for her engaging presentations on the history of beer and brewing as well as guided tours of Cleveland breweries, this event promises to be both educational and delicious!

Please note, the small bites paired with the beer tasting include meat, dairy, and gluten.
